PEL Learning Centers is dedicated to empowering children, particularly those facing challenges such as language-based learning disabilities and other academic hurdles. With a core mission focused on maximizing each child's potential, PEL offers individualized programs in math and English that are designed to foster both academic and personal growth. Utilizing a proven methodology that emphasizes character transformation, students engage in a structured learning process that includes concept introduction, coaching support, and gradual independence through scaffolding techniques. This approach not only enhances academic skills but also builds essential life skills such as goal-setting, organization, and persistence. What sets PEL apart is its commitment to maintaining a low student-teacher ratio, ensuring personalized attention for every child. Additionally, the center fosters strong partnerships with families, creating a supportive community that celebrates each child's progress through unique events and activities tailored to their needs.

Nea is a dedicated educational institution located in the West End of Alameda, California, serving students from transitional kindergarten through eighth grade. Since its establishment in 2009, the school has embraced a core mission centered on fostering a nurturing and inclusive environment that supports a diverse range of learners, including those with language-based learning disabilities and twice-exceptional students. Nea employs a project-based learning approach, which not only engages students but also cultivates a lifelong passion for education. This methodology is complemented by tailored therapeutic programs designed to address individual needs, ensuring that each child receives the support necessary for their unique learning journey. What sets Nea apart is its commitment to maintaining a low student-teacher ratio, allowing for personalized attention and strong family partnerships that enhance the educational experience. The school also boasts specialized facilities that cater to various learning styles and needs, alongside community events that foster collaboration and connection among families. This holistic approach ensures that every student at Nea is not only educated but also empowered to thrive both academically and socially.

The Child Unique Montessori School, located in Alameda, California, is a distinguished private preschool and K-6 educational institution dedicated to fostering an inclusive community where diversity, equity, justice, and belonging are not just ideals but integral parts of the learning experience. Serving children aged 18 months to 12 years, including those with language-based learning disabilities and twice-exceptional students, the school offers a nurturing environment that encourages creativity, curiosity, self-confidence, and independence. The curriculum is thoughtfully designed to instill a love for learning while promoting respect and understanding of oneself and others. The school employs innovative anti-bias education methodologies that have garnered recognition, including features on PBS News Hour. With three campuses across Alameda Island, students benefit from low student-teacher ratios that foster personalized attention. The facilities include spacious classrooms filled with natural light, inviting outdoor spaces for play and exploration, and dedicated areas for arts and performance. Additionally, unique community events enhance family partnerships and create a strong support network for parents and guardians. The Child Unique Montessori School stands out as a transformative educational environment where every child is empowered to thrive in an ever-evolving world.
